About N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ide
N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ide (PubChem CID 20899204) has the molecular formula C18H19N3O3S2
and a molecular weight of 389.50 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ide is O=C(NCC(c1cccs1)N1CCOCC1)c1cc(-c2cccs2)on1.
What is the InChIKey of N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ide?
The InChIKey is OFSOZKRGFZBNMJ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C18H19N3O3S2/c22-18(13-11-15(24-20-13)17-4-2-10-26-17)19-12-14(16-3-1-9-25-16)21-5-7-23-8-6-21/h1-4,9-11,14H,5-8,12H2,(H,19,22).
What are the key properties of N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ide?
N-(2-morpholin-4-yl-2-thiophen-2-ylethyl)-5-thiophen-2-yl-1,2-oxazole-3-carboxamide has a molecular weight of 389.50 g/mol, XLogP of 3.27, 6 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 7 hydrogen bond acceptors.
